>
具体错误 orgaspectjweaverreflectReflectionWorld$ReflectionWorldException解决方案确保项目中包含aspectjweaver了AspectJ的依赖包aspectjweaver,通常是aspectjweaverjar这个包可以从Spring官方下载的jar包中的aspectj目录中找到,或者通过MavenGradle等构建工具添加相应依赖配置错误可能原因。
最少需要11个jar包,分别是springcontextjar commonsloggingjar aspectjrtjar springcorejar aspectjweaverjar springbeansjar springexpressionjar springwebjar springtxjar springaopjar aopalliancejar JARJava ARchive,Java 归档是一种与平台无关的文件格式,可将多个文件。
2aspectjweaverjar开始讲解用Spring AOP的XML实现方式,先定义一个接口public interface HelloWorld void printHelloWorld void doPrint定义两个接口实现类public class HelloWorldImpl1 implements HelloWorld public void printHelloWorldquotEnter HelloWorldImpl1printHelloWorldquot。
1如果使用xml方式,不需要任何额外的jar包2如果使用@Aspect方式,你就可以在类上直接一个@Aspect就搞定,不用费事在xml里配了但是这需要额外的jar包 aspectjweaverjar因为spring直接使用AspectJ的注解功能,注意只是使用了它 的注解功能而已并不是核心功能 注意到文档上还有一句很。
aspectjrtjar 与 aspectjweaverjar通过Annotation方式实现AOP面向切面编程cglibnodep21_3jar一个强大的代码生成库,可以在运行时扩展Java类javassist390GAjar另一个代码生成工具,Hibernate用它在运行时扩展Java类和实现图表生成jfreechart1012jar使用Java生成图表的。

的bean原因是Java类定义未找到错误具体错误信息为 orgaspectjweaverreflectReflectionWorld$ReflectionWorldException 问题根源在于缺少依赖包解决此问题的方法是添加aspectjweaverjar包如果是从Spring的官方下载的jar包,通常可以在提供的aspectj目录中找到此依赖包。
除了基本的spring jar包外,还需要aspectjrtjaraspectjweaverjar和cglibnodep21_3jar前两个是对AOP的支持的,cglib是支持动态代理的jar。

相关标签 :
上一篇: 动态链接库dll初始化例程失败,动态链接库dll初始化例程失败怎么办
下一篇: 挣钱网站,挣钱网站平台
微信医疗(登记+咨询+回访)预约管理系统
云约CRM微信小程序APP系统定制开发
云约CRM体检自定义出号预约管理系统
云约CRM云诊所系统,云门诊,医疗预约音视频在线问诊预约系统
云约CRM新版美容微信预约系统门店版_门店预约管理系统
云约CRM最新ThinkPHP6通用行业的预约小程序(诊所挂号)系统联系电话:18300931024
在线QQ客服:616139763
官方微信:18300931024
官方邮箱: 616139763@qq.com